March 12, the President of the Philippines declared a lockdown on the National Capital Region of Manila from March 15 until April 14. Government officials closed schools down on March 9 and then permanently on March 13. This fit nicely into our March Break, March 14-22, but instead of going back to classes, teachers did online training, learning how to teach our students in a totally different format. Our students had been doing things online, but with no direct contact we learned how to do Zoom classrooms and sending assignments through Loom and Flipgrid. Our first day of online classes was Friday, March 27.
